technologyliberalFarm to Tech: My Journey to InnovateChina-USA, China USAWednesday, December 18, 2024AdvertisementAdvertisementgooglechinaActionsflag contentPoorly writtenDuplicateInappropriateWrong locationBad formattingFalse InformationPotential Copyright/Trademark Violation